EMPOWER West Africa Project Overview

EMPOWER West Africa is a humanitarian partnership and capacity strengthening initiative focused on strengthening local leadership in humanitarian responses through institutional strengthening, capacity building, accompaniment and direcgt funding for local humanitarian actors. The project is being implemented in Burkina Faso, Ghana, Guinea, Liberia, Mali, Niger, Senegal, The Gamia, and Sierra Leone to address immediate shocks and long-term challenges, promote transformative peace, and provide life-giving solutions.

This document provides a brief overview of the project, its approach and its intended outcomes.
